Output 863fbabac27c0065a334d0191da134f9053791726c487dfdc19d1212f5f00aab:1

value
20606
script pubkey
OP_0 OP_PUSHBYTES_32 185dd592b8267a30db30986342a9cc62666b3fafcf912ce6af534f3cc0366a54
address
bc1qrpwaty4cyearpkesnp3592wvvfnxk0a0e7gjee402d8nespkdf2qml35tv
transaction
863fbabac27c0065a334d0191da134f9053791726c487dfdc19d1212f5f00aab